Incandescent Bulbs
Incandescent bulbs are the traditional choice for many households and businesses. They produce light by heating a filament until it glows, resulting in a warm, inviting glow. While they are inexpensive to purchase, their energy efficiency is relatively low, converting only about 10% of energy into light, with the rest lost as heat.
Despite their inefficiency, incandescent bulbs have a high color rendering index (CRI), which means they render colors more accurately than many other types of bulbs. This quality makes them ideal for applications where color accuracy is paramount, such as in art galleries or retail spaces. However, due to their short lifespan and high energy consumption, they may not be the best choice for long-term lighting projects. Additionally, the warm light emitted by incandescent bulbs can create a cozy atmosphere, making them a popular choice for living rooms and dining areas, where comfort and ambiance are key considerations.
Compact Fluorescent Lamps (CFLs)
CFLs emerged as a popular alternative to incandescent bulbs, offering improved energy efficiency and a longer lifespan. These bulbs use a gas-filled tube that emits ultraviolet light, which then excites a fluorescent coating inside the bulb to produce visible light. CFLs consume about 75% less energy than incandescent bulbs and can last up to ten times longer.
However, CFLs have a few drawbacks. They take time to reach full brightness and may be sensitive to temperature fluctuations, which can affect performance. Additionally, they contain small amounts of mercury, necessitating careful disposal. Despite these challenges, the energy savings and longer lifespan can lead to significant ROI in commercial and residential settings. Moreover, many CFLs are now available in various shapes and sizes, making them adaptable for different fixtures and applications, from table lamps to recessed lighting, thus providing a practical solution for diverse lighting needs.
Light Emitting Diodes (LEDs)
LEDs have revolutionized the lighting industry with their exceptional energy efficiency and versatility. These bulbs emit light through a semiconductor, using significantly less energy than both incandescent and CFLs. LEDs can last up to 25 times longer than incandescent bulbs, making them a cost-effective choice in the long run.
One of the standout features of LEDs is their ability to produce a wide range of color temperatures, from warm white to cool daylight. This flexibility allows for tailored lighting solutions that can enhance mood and productivity in various environments. Furthermore, LEDs are highly durable and resistant to shock, making them suitable for both indoor and outdoor applications. Their low heat emission also means they can be used in enclosed fixtures without the risk of overheating, making them a safe choice for a variety of settings. Additionally, the advent of smart LED technology has further expanded their functionality, allowing users to control brightness and color remotely, thereby creating dynamic lighting experiences that can adapt to any occasion or preference.
Evaluating ROI in Lighting Projects
maximizing ROI in lighting projects requires a comprehensive evaluation of costs, benefits, and long-term savings. Understanding the total cost of ownership (TCO) is essential for making informed decisions that align with financial goals.
Initial Costs vs. Long-Term Savings
While the initial cost of purchasing light bulbs can vary significantly, it is crucial to consider the long-term savings associated with energy efficiency and lifespan. For instance, although LED bulbs may have a higher upfront cost compared to incandescent or CFLs, their energy savings and longevity can lead to substantial cost reductions over time.
Calculating the total cost of ownership involves factoring in not just the purchase price of the bulbs, but also energy costs, maintenance expenses, and replacement frequency. By analyzing these elements, businesses and homeowners can make more strategic decisions that enhance ROI.
Energy Efficiency and Sustainability
Energy efficiency is a critical component of ROI in lighting projects. Choosing bulbs with higher efficiency ratings can lead to reduced energy consumption, which translates to lower utility bills. Additionally, energy-efficient lighting contributes to sustainability goals by reducing carbon footprints and promoting eco-friendly practices.
Incorporating smart lighting systems can further enhance energy savings. These systems allow for automated control of lighting based on occupancy or daylight availability, ensuring that lights are only used when needed. Such innovations not only improve energy efficiency but also enhance user experience and comfort.
Maintenance and Replacement Costs
Maintenance and replacement costs are often overlooked when evaluating ROI. Bulbs with shorter lifespans require more frequent replacements, leading to increased labor and material costs. In contrast, investing in longer-lasting bulbs like LEDs can minimize these expenses, resulting in significant savings over time.
Furthermore, the ease of installation and maintenance should be considered. Some lighting solutions require specialized equipment or expertise for installation, which can add to overall costs. Opting for user-friendly lighting options can streamline maintenance processes and reduce downtime.

Color Temperature and Mood
The color temperature of light plays a significant role in shaping the mood and functionality of a space. Warmer color temperatures (around 2700K-3000K) are often preferred in residential settings for their cozy, inviting feel. In contrast, cooler temperatures (4000K-5000K) are more suitable for workspaces, promoting alertness and productivity.
Choosing the right color temperature can enhance the overall experience in a space, making it essential to consider the emotional and psychological effects of lighting. By aligning the color temperature with the intended use of the area, one can create an environment that meets both aesthetic and functional needs.
Budget Considerations
Budget constraints are a common consideration in any lighting project. While it may be tempting to opt for the cheapest option available, it is essential to evaluate the long-term implications of such decisions. Investing in higher-quality, energy-efficient bulbs can yield substantial savings over time, making them a more prudent choice.
Additionally, exploring available rebates and incentives for energy-efficient lighting can further enhance ROI. Many utility companies and government programs offer financial incentives for upgrading to energy-efficient solutions, reducing the overall cost of lighting projects.

Smart Lighting Systems
Smart lighting systems allow for advanced control and automation of lighting, providing users with the ability to customize their lighting experience. These systems can be programmed to adjust based on time of day, occupancy, or even user preferences, resulting in optimized energy usage and enhanced comfort.
Moreover, smart lighting can integrate with other building management systems, contributing to overall energy savings and operational efficiency. The initial investment in smart lighting technology can be offset by the long-term benefits of reduced energy consumption and increased user satisfaction.
Dynamic Lighting Solutions
Dynamic lighting solutions, such as tunable white or color-changing LEDs, offer unprecedented flexibility in lighting design. These systems allow users to adjust the color temperature and intensity of light, creating tailored environments for various activities and moods.
In commercial settings, dynamic lighting can enhance employee productivity and well-being by mimicking natural daylight patterns. This adaptability not only improves the overall experience but can also lead to increased employee satisfaction and retention, further enhancing ROI.
